A great 3 days for Nick Brown Racing and Stuart Edmunds and his hardworking team! Sneaking Budge a comfortable winner on a Sandown Saturday card - showing a fantastic attitude in heavy ground - jumping for fun, and showing a deal of promise for the future, and then Cloonacool showing he is a class act in Ludlow yesterday. 'George' is a model of consistency, and has only run one indifferent race for us. All of his jockeys have said what a suoer chaser he would make and yesterday he took a big step in that direction. On just his second chase start, we asked him to give upwards of 10lbs to all of his rivals, and he handed them a very hollow beating. Josh bided his time early, and despite the pace at the start being akin to the Grand Annual, C still took a bit of a grip. He settled eventually, and jumped right through to share the lead half way down the back. At this point Josh said the opposition just couldn't live with him, and he was still taking a pull out of him turning in. He took it up 2 out, and despite running down the last, and idling on the run in - won easily. He seems fine this morning, and we look to have him out again in late Jan or early Feb - when a rise in grade looks on the card.
